Checking out temples: Numerous temples devoted to Maa Baglamukhi can be found in India along with other portions of the globe. Going to these temples and taking part in rituals and prayers is usually a powerful way to attach with the goddess. It is actually thought that her mere existence https://www.youtube.com/shorts/5VeSyP9JRw0